SCHOLARSHIPS AWARDED TO ALLEGANY COLLEGE OF MARYLAND STUDENTS

CUMBERLAND, Md. (Nov. 29, 2021) – The Allegany College of Maryland Foundation announces that the following students were awarded scholarships to attend Allegany College of Maryland: Sarah Myers, Flintstone, American Legion Post #13 Robert W. Hartsock Scholarship; Avery Nies, Cumberland, Robert E. Pence Memorial Christian Scholarship, Sheriff Donald Wade and Alda Wade Memorial Scholarship; Michelle Orner, Grantsville, Vietnam Veterans of America Chapter 172 Scholarship; Jessica Riggleman, Green Spring, Vietnam Veterans of America, Chapter 172 Scholarship; Payton Sharpless, Cumberland, Ivan and Charlotte Hall Scholarship; Shad Short, Cumberland, William F. Lashbaugh, Jr. Memorial Scholarship; Peyton Smith, Frostburg, May B. Bolt Memorial Scholarship; Kailee Wilson, Lonaconing, Iron Furnace 5K Run Scholarship, Vietnam Veterans of America, Chapter #172 Scholarship; Aisa Wrights, Cumberland, Cumberland Lions Club Memorial Scholarship, Vietnam Veterans of America, Chapter #172 Scholarship; and Lexis Zalewski, LaVale, American Legion Post #13 Robert W. Hartsock Memorial Scholarship.
